Domaine Grand Veneur is a renowned Chateauneuf du Pape estate run by the skilful Alaine Jaume and his two sons. Alain is famous for his excellent White Chateauneuf but he also has a small parcel of Viognier, planted in the small vineyard of Les Champauvins near Coudelet, just outside the Chateauneuf AC to the North, thus its Côtes de Rhône AC. He vinifies this in stainless steel to keep the freshness and vibrant peachy, apricoty smells and flavours of the Viognier. This is a lovely glass, fresh enough to make a perfect aperitif and full enough to take on most foods.
